Home
last modified time | relevance | path

Searched refs:ShaderCase (Results 1 – 25 of 26) sorted by relevance

12

/external/deqp/external/openglcts/modules/common/
DglcShaderLibraryCase.cpp80 ShaderCase::ShaderCase(tcu::TestContext& testCtx, RenderContext& renderCtx, const char* name, const… in ShaderCase() function in deqp::sl::ShaderCase
119 ShaderCase::~ShaderCase(void) in ~ShaderCase()
124 const ShaderCase::Value& val, int arrayNdx) in setUniformValue()
131 DE_STATIC_ASSERT(sizeof(ShaderCase::Value::Element) == sizeof(glw::GLfloat)); in setUniformValue()
132 DE_STATIC_ASSERT(sizeof(ShaderCase::Value::Element) == sizeof(glw::GLint)); in setUniformValue()
224 bool ShaderCase::checkPixels(Surface& surface, int minX, int maxX, int minY, int maxY) in checkPixels()
265 bool ShaderCase::execute(void) in execute()
378 const ShaderCase::Value& val = valueBlock.values[valNdx]; in execute()
385 if (val.storageType == ShaderCase::Value::STORAGE_INPUT) in execute()
446 else if (val.storageType == ShaderCase::Value::STORAGE_OUTPUT) in execute()
[all …]
DglcShaderLibraryCase.hpp43 class ShaderCase : public tcu::TestCase class
101ShaderCase(tcu::TestContext& testCtx, glu::RenderContext& renderCtx, const char* caseName, const c…
105 virtual ~ShaderCase(void);
128 ShaderCase(const ShaderCase&); // not allowed!
129 ShaderCase& operator=(const ShaderCase&); // not allowed!
DglcShaderLibrary.cpp177 void parseValueElement(DataType dataType, ShaderCase::Value& result);
178 void parseValue(ShaderCase::ValueBlock& valueBlock);
179 void parseValueBlock(ShaderCase::ValueBlock& valueBlock);
740 void ShaderParser::parseValueElement(DataType expectedDataType, ShaderCase::Value& result) in parseValueElement()
746 ShaderCase::Value::Element elems[16]; in parseValueElement()
804 void ShaderParser::parseValue(ShaderCase::ValueBlock& valueBlock) in parseValue()
809 ShaderCase::Value result; in parseValue()
813 result.storageType = ShaderCase::Value::STORAGE_UNIFORM; in parseValue()
815 result.storageType = ShaderCase::Value::STORAGE_INPUT; in parseValue()
817 result.storageType = ShaderCase::Value::STORAGE_OUTPUT; in parseValue()
[all …]
/external/deqp/modules/gles31/scripts/
Dgen-implicit-conversions.py339 class ArithmeticCase(genutil.ShaderCase):
442 class ParenthesizedCase(genutil.ShaderCase):
502 class FunctionsCase(genutil.ShaderCase):
533 class ArrayCase(genutil.ShaderCase):
577 class ArrayUnpackCase(genutil.ShaderCase):
653 class StructCase(genutil.ShaderCase):
702 class InvalidCase(genutil.ShaderCase):
735 class InvalidArrayCase(genutil.ShaderCase):
756 class InvalidStructCase(genutil.ShaderCase):
Dgen-uniform-blocks.py74 class UniformBlockCase(ShaderCase):
Dgenutil.py38 class ShaderCase(object): class
/external/deqp/modules/gles2/scripts/
Dgen-conversions.py160 class SimpleCase(ShaderCase):
175 class ConversionCase(ShaderCase):
193 class IllegalConversionCase(ShaderCase):
209 class CombineCase(ShaderCase):
Dgen-qualification_order.py101 class DeclarationCase(ShaderCase):
136 class ParameterCase(ShaderCase):
Dgen-keywords.py52 class IdentifierCase(ShaderCase):
Dgen-reserved_operators.py52 class ReservedOperatorCase(ShaderCase):
Dgen-invalid-implicit-conversions.py73 class InvalidImplicitConversionCase(ShaderCase):
Dgen-swizzles.py166 class SwizzleCase(ShaderCase):
Dgenutil.py38 class ShaderCase: class
/external/deqp/modules/gles3/scripts/
Dgen-qualification_order.py107 class DeclarationCase(ShaderCase):
151 class ParameterCase(ShaderCase):
Dgen-conversions.py173 class SimpleCase(ShaderCase):
188 class ConversionCase(ShaderCase):
206 class IllegalConversionCase(ShaderCase):
222 class CombineCase(ShaderCase):
Dgen-keywords.py53 class IdentifierCase(ShaderCase):
Dgen-invalid-implicit-conversions.py77 class InvalidImplicitConversionCase(ShaderCase):
Dgen-invalid-texture-funcs.py56 class InvalidTexFuncCase(ShaderCase):
Dgen-large-constant-arrays.py58 class LargeConstantArrayCase(ShaderCase):
Dgen-swizzle-math-operations.py92 class SwizzleCase(ShaderCase):
Dgen-swizzles.py170 class SwizzleCase(ShaderCase):
Dgen-uniform-blocks.py74 class UniformBlockCase(ShaderCase):
Dgenutil.py38 class ShaderCase(object): class
/external/deqp/external/vulkancts/modules/vulkan/
DvktShaderLibrary.cpp1683 class ShaderCase : public TestCase class
1686ShaderCase (tcu::TestContext& testCtx, const string& name, const string& description, const Shade…
1696 ShaderCase::ShaderCase (tcu::TestContext& testCtx, const string& name, const string& description, c… in ShaderCase() function in vkt::__anond1e616c90111::ShaderCase
1702 void ShaderCase::initPrograms (SourceCollections& sourceCollection) const in initPrograms()
1750 TestInstance* ShaderCase::createInstance (Context& context) const in createInstance()
1770 return new ShaderCase(m_testCtx, name, description, spec); in createCase()
/external/deqp/external/openglcts/modules/gl/
Dgl3cTransformFeedbackTests.hpp656 static const struct ShaderCase struct in gl3cts::TransformFeedback::CheckGetXFBVarying

12